What Are Non-Custodial Wallets?

A non-custodial wallet, also known as a self-custody wallet, is a type of digital wallet that allows users to have full control over their private keys. Unlike custodial wallets, which store users' private keys on centralized servers, non-custodial wallets store these keys locally on the user's device. This gives users complete ownership and control over their funds, making it significantly harder for hackers to gain unauthorized access to their assets.

The Security Benefits of Non-Custodial Wallets

Non-custodial wallets offer several security benefits compared to custodial wallets. Firstly, by storing private keys locally, non-custodial wallets eliminate the risk of a centralized server being hacked or compromised. This significantly reduces the chances of funds being stolen or misused. Secondly, non-custodial wallets use encryption techniques to secure private keys, adding an extra layer of protection. Lastly, non-custodial wallets also allow users to back up their private keys offline, providing an additional safeguard against loss or theft.

Decentralization and Trust

One of the key advantages of non-custodial wallets is their decentralized nature. By eliminating the need for third-party custodians, non-custodial wallets empower individuals to have full control over their assets. This decentralization reduces the reliance on trust in centralized entities, making transactions more secure and transparent. Users can verify and validate their transactions independently without having to rely on intermediaries.

The Importance of Private Keys

Private keys play a crucial role in secure payments using non-custodial wallets. These keys are unique cryptographic codes that grant access to the user's funds. It is essential to keep private keys secure and confidential to prevent unauthorized access. Non-custodial wallets ensure that users have exclusive control over their private keys, reducing the risk of theft or fraud.

Enhancing Privacy

Non-custodial wallets also contribute to enhancing privacy in secure payments. With custodial wallets, users often have to provide personal information and undergo identity verification processes. Non-custodial wallets, on the other hand, do not require users to disclose personal information, ensuring a higher level of privacy. This feature makes non-custodial wallets an attractive option for individuals who prioritize privacy and anonymity.
